Forestry Supervisor Bradford Latham Appeal to Public on Disrupted Wildlife Species

Details
Published: 02 July 2025

The Forestry Services of Saint Vincent and the Grenadines in the Ministry of Agriculture is appealing to the public to refrain from capturing and disrupting wildlife species such as the Iguana (Green Iguana and Pink Rhino Iguana), Armadillo (tattoo), Agouti and Opossum (manicou), in the current closed season.

Forestry Services And UNDP Ridge to Reef Program Conduct Assessment And Training Activities on Forest Fires Prevention And Response

Details
Published: 02 July 2025

A delegation from the Ministry of Agriculture, Rural Transformation, Forestry, Fisheries, Industry and Labour, alongside representatives from the United Nations Development Programme (UNDP) Ridge to Reef Project, were in Union Island from May 6 to 8, 2025 to conduct assessments and training activities on forest fires prevention and response.
